The U.S. President Donald Trump has publicly accused his predecessor Barack Obama many times of committing crimes but without any proof. Now he has falsely accused Obama of committing treason for “spying on his campaign.”

In an interview that aired on Monday, June 22, Trump, once again without any evidence, tried to accuse Obama of committing a crime. He said that the former president has committed treason for spying on his campaign.

"It's treason," he said. "Look, when I came out a long time ago, I said they've been spying on my campaign. I said they've been taping, and that was in quotes, meaning a modern-day version of taping, it's all the same thing. But a modern-day version. But they've been spying on my campaign."

In the U.S. Consitution, "Treason against the United States, shall consist only in levying War against them, or in adhering to their Enemies, giving them Aid and Comfort."

There is no evidence that Obama committing any sort of treason that reached up to the definition as per the constitution of the country. Neither there is any record or proof of him spying on Trump’s campaign.

This is not the first time that Obama has been accused of something without any concrete evidence or proof available. It has been claimed several times before that Democratic partisan within the Justice Department and the FBI have made use of their position to undermine Trump and investigate into his campaign.

Some misconduct, however, has been reported before concerning former FBI officials and their misconduct related to the Russian investigation. However, the extent of the misconduct has been widely exaggerated by Trump by making unproven claims and accusations that even people from his administration have not been able to explain.

"I just hope I get tremendous evangelical Christian support," said Trump, after saying that Obama and his people spied on the opposing party's campaign, however, they caught them.

"We're in a different time. You understand what I mean by that,” he further said, claiming that if Obama and people in his administration were found committing this treason 50 to 100 years ago, they would have been executed.
